What is pnscan

pnscan is:

Pnscan is a multi threaded port scanner that can scan a large network very quickly. If does not have all the features that nmap have but is much faster.

There are three methods to install pnscan on Debian 9. We can use apt-get, apt and aptitude. In the following sections we will describe each method. You can choose one of them.

Install pnscan Using apt-get

Update apt database with apt-get using the following command.

sudo apt-get update

After updating apt database, We can install pnscan using apt-get by running the following command:

sudo apt-get -y install pnscan

How To Uninstall pnscan on Debian 9

To uninstall only the pnscan package we can use the following command:

sudo apt-get remove pnscan

Uninstall pnscan And Its Dependencies

To uninstall pnscan and its dependencies that are no longer needed by Debian 9, we can use the command below:

sudo apt-get -y autoremove pnscan

Remove pnscan Configurations and Data

To remove pnscan configuration and data from Debian 9 we can use the following command:

sudo apt-get -y purge pnscan

Remove pnscan configuration, data, and all of its dependencies

We can use the following command to remove pnscan configurations, data and all of its dependencies, we can use the following command:

sudo apt-get -y autoremove --purge pnscan
